What is considered Disorderly Behavior?

Disorderly behavior is defined as conduct that causes public alarm, nuisance, or recklessness. Examples of disorderly behavior include fighting in public, creating a hazardous environment for others, and being overly vocal. How to Respond When Accused of Disorderly BehaviorHow To Answer If You're Accused Of Disorderly Behavior

It is important that you remain calm and courteous. Take a step back and listen to the accusations being made. If you do not understand something that is said or if you are not sure why you are being accused, ask politely for clarification. It may be helpful to record the names of any officers present and take notes on the accusations and situation.

When answering questions, be honest but remain brief in your responses. Do not argue or become hostile. You have the right to remain silent or ask for an attorney, so do not feel obligated to provide additional information if you do not want to.

What if I am Arrested?

If you happen to be arrested, it is important to comply with the officer’s orders. Do not resist arrest or attempt to flee as this can result in additional charges being brought against you. Instead, follow the instructions given by law enforcement while remaining courteous and cooperative at all times. 

It is also important to understand what rights you have when you are arrested. You have the right to remain silent, the right to an attorney, and the right to be treated fairly and without excessive force. Knowing your rights can help you protect yourself from any wrongful accusations or mistreatment while in custody.
